A primary school in the Islington area of central London are seeking a Key Stage 2 Teacher to start with them in September 2019, with flexibility on year group, and competitive salary available in line with experience (MPS 1-6 Inner London - £29,663-£40,371).
Situated in the heart of trendy Angel in Islington, this unique and charming school seeks creative minded teachers to help them move into the next phase of their development.
With a newly established Head and Leadership, the school are seeking lively, talented teachers who thrive on making a difference for children and want to be part of creating their early vision and development.
The school are fortunate to have recently become part of a prestigious academy trust which offers opportunities to tap into a strong group of Church of England schools who are driven by the desire to improve, through networking, sharing of expertise and offering exciting learning opportunities, whilst also enjoying working closely with other Islington schools.
You will be a key driver in the school's next phase of improvement, helping implement an innovative, creative and an exciting primary curriculum. This is an incredibly exciting opportunity for a primary teacher who believes in making learning fun, lively and creative; a unique challenge for the teacher who wants to be part of something new.
The responsibilities for this Key Stage 2 Class Teacher role will include
*Carry out teaching duties to meet objectives specified in the school's schemes of work and National Curriculum
*To assess, record and report on the attendance, progress, development and attainment of assigned pupils as defined by school policy
*To provide a high quality learning experience for pupils
*To work as a member of a specified team and contribute positively to effective working relationships within the school
*Provide or contribute to assessment reports to monitor student progress
The ideal candidate for this Key Stage 2 Teacher role will have:
*passion and high expectations for children;
*a proven track record in raising pupil attainment;
*an understanding of how children learn and the ability to adapt;
*an inclusive and can-do mindset;
*a creative and innovative approach to school improvement;
*strong interpersonal skills.
As part of this Key Stage 2 teacher role, the school can offer an amazing opportunity to progress your career. They will support your professional development and give you opportunities to flourish as a leader through quality training providers, professional links with other academy trust schools and Islington Council.

To work in the UK, you must:
*Be eligible to gain UK employment status (Youth Mobility Visa, Ancestry Visa, EU or British Passport - check out https://www.gov.uk/apply-uk-visa).
*Have relevant teaching qualifications for working in UK schools and all candidates are subject to an enhanced DBS police check.
